Joshua Varela is a well rounded musician from Southern California where he received his Bachelors of Arts degree in Music Industry Studies from California State University Of Northridge (CSUN). While attending CSUN Joshua worked at James Monroe High School as their Drum, Piano and Recording Tech in the music program. Before CSUN Joshua was attending Mt San Antonio College with the goal to receive an Associates degree in music. During this time period Joshua was performing in the Mt San Antonio Wind Ensemble as the principal timpanist, as well as performing for the Ontario Community Show Band for about 4 years. Joshua’s primary instruments are Percussion, Piano, Drums and Bass.
“My goal for the students is to gain the knowledge I never had at their age, so they can get a head start on their musical careers”. Joshua’s teaching style is encouraging and friendly but there is a strong emphasis on technique because the fundamentals are the core factor of becoming a great musician. Another attribute Joshua teaches about is time management and the importance of balancing practice in one’s life.
